C语言中绝对值函数的实现方法
摘要:
在C语言中,绝对值函数的实现是通过使用条件语句来判断数值的正负,然后返回其绝对值,该函数接受一个整数或浮点数作为输入,如果输入值为正数或零,则返回该值;如果输入值为负数,则返回该值的相反数,这种实现方式简单明了,是C语言中处理数值问题的一种基础方法。
本文介绍了如何使用C语言编写返回绝对值函数,该函数接受一个整数作为输入参数,并返回该整数的绝对值,通过使用条件语句判断输入值的正负,然后返回相应的绝对值,该函数简单易用,适用于各种需要计算绝对值的场景。
C语言中如何理解绝对值函数及其返回值?
今天我们将探讨C语言中如何获取一个数的绝对值,无论是整数还是浮点数,C语言都提供了相应的绝对值函数。
文章目录:
- C语言中如何取绝对值?
- C语言绝对值函数介绍
- 如何使用C语言的fabs函数?
C语言中如何取绝对值? 在C语言中,求取一个数的绝对值可以通过两种方法实现,你可以使用标准库提供的函数,这些函数可以处理整数和浮点数,你也可以通过编写条件语句来实现求绝对值的功能。
C语言绝对值函数介绍 C语言中有两个绝对值函数:abs() 和 fabs(),abs() 用于处理整数,而 fabs() 用于处理浮点数,这两个函数都包含在 math.h 头文件中,它们分别返回给定整数或浮点数的绝对值。
如何使用C语言的fabs函数? 使用fabs函数非常简单,你需要在代码中包含math.h头文件,调用fabs函数并传入一个浮点数作为参数,函数将返回该浮点数的绝对值。
#include <math.h> #include <stdio.h> int main() { double num = -6.5; double abs_value = fabs(num); printf("The absolute value of %.2f is %.2f\n", num, abs_value); return 0; }
在这个例子中,我们使用了fabs函数来计算变量num的绝对值,并将结果存储在abs_value中,我们使用printf函数打印出结果。
本文介绍了C语言中如何获取一个数的绝对值,我们了解了abs() 和 fabs() 这两个绝对值函数,并学习了如何使用fabs函数来计算浮点数的绝对值,希望这篇文章能够帮助你更好地理解C语言中的绝对值函数及其返回值。